Community Update: ICE Incident Near City Hall On July 23, 2025, ICE agents conducted a targeted arrest outside Fircrest City Hall. We want to reassure our community: this was not a raid, and Fircrest PD was not involved or notified in advance. Fircrest Police do not enforce federal civil immigration…

The City of Fircrest has issued a Determination of Nonsignificance for the City’s proposed Six-Year Transportation Improvement Program for the years 2026-2031. The City has determined that the proposal does not have a probable significant adverse impact on the environment. An environmental impact statement (EIS) is not required for the…
The City of Fircrest is pleased to announce the selection of Victor Celis as the City’s next Chief of Police. City Manager Dawn Masko extended an offer of employment earlier today, which Mr. Celis officially accepted. He will assume his new role on July 1, 2025. “Selecting our next Police…
